Software Companies In Indianapolis Fundamentals Explained

Wiki Article

The Greatest Guide To Software Companies In Indianapolis

Table of ContentsAn Unbiased View of Software Companies In IndianapolisSoftware Companies In Indianapolis Fundamentals ExplainedHow Software Companies In Indianapolis can Save You Time, Stress, and Money.The Ultimate Guide To Software Companies In IndianapolisLittle Known Facts About Software Companies In Indianapolis.Software Companies In Indianapolis Fundamentals Explained
PHP is still extensively used as well as thought about a good language for novices in programming languages. PHP specialists have actually numerous specialized online discussion forums as well as neighborhoods where they can obtain aid as well as answers to inquiries. SQL is a programming language widely made use of for upgrading, getting, and controling data sources. Nearly every app has a back-end database, and also SQL helps them engage with the information in those data sources.


The factor for this is the fast adoption of the most recent software application development modern technologies in a variety of industries like health care, production, and accounting. The demand for software program development abilities is expected to enhance in the coming years. As you maintain up with the news regarding software program growth and the present trends, you might additionally be interested in these brand-new and future innovations.

In essence, software is a collection of guidelines or programs that govern a system's actions. Software application development consists of the procedure of producing, creating, releasing, as well as sustaining software application.

This software aids individuals do jobs. Instances include office applications, data monitoring software application, media gamers, security programs, and more.

The smart Trick of Software Companies In Indianapolis That Nobody is Talking About

While Dev, Ops can supply a selection of benefits, it can be problematic for a variety of organizations. This is particularly true for companies that are not well suited to having applications constantly updated. This can consist of companies with rigorous governing demands and also with clients that have constraints around upgrade regularity.

Generally, the process complies with these phases: needs, layout, implementation, verification, as well as upkeep. Each stage has a distinct purpose, and also each step must be finished totally prior to transferring to the next. In several companies, this represents the typical strategy, so it is typically comfortable as well as well recognized for several employee.

Software Companies in IndianapolisSoftware Companies in Indianapolis
In addition, it can be hard for groups to adjust to transforming requirements that might arise during advancement. This is a non-linear advancement method that condenses layout as well as code building.

Within most organizations, groups establish various atmospheres for growth, testing, staging, and production. In this way, developers can produce and also innovate, without breaking anything in the manufacturing setting. A complex set of parts are required for each and every software program advancement environment: A physical or digital maker, including an underlying operating system, data source system, and so forth.

Some Known Questions About Software Companies In Indianapolis.

A software development environment can play a large function in the stability, integrity, and utmost success of a software offering. These atmospheres: Play an essential function in software application production, management, and maintenance.

In making this choice, teams must try to find a remedy that is well lined up with the sort of application being developed, consisting of appropriate languages, platforms, deployments, devices, and so forth. additional hints A programmer might desire to produce an app that can run on i, OS as well as Android mobile devices, as well as through a web page.

With Dev, Zero, designers can create new atmospheres by logging onto a console and choosing from numerous themes or producing their very own templates. Whenever needed, developers can conveniently share their atmospheres, so others can engage with solutions running on their themes. For more information, make certain to go to the Dev, Zero product page.

The 3 primary locations of development planning are Demands Collecting, Preparation and Layout, and Study and also Advancement. The major stakeholders are normally clients, so target tests can be a great means to make clear essential problems when functioning with a tiny sample of the target market.

The smart Trick of Software Companies In Indianapolis That Nobody is Talking About

Functions are damaged down right into smaller jobs so that they can be approximated more precisely (Software Companies in Indianapolis). The stage is a bit similar to the preparation phase. When some significant attributes are new, important, and dangerous, you have to carry out research concerning their implementation to decrease these threats in the manufacturing phase

To produce an effective software program development plan, it is very essential to comprehend how essential its quality is to the success of the product. Below are the most usual stages of a software program development job. You can utilize them as a guide when outlining the phases as well as aspects of any type of project.



Here are some essential points to keep in mind: Placement. Exactly how does this job matched the goal and goals of the company? Resources. Does the business have this content enough resources to make the project a success? Preparation. Exactly how does this project fit in with the routine of various other tasks and also objectives? Price.

Defining goals is also essential for creating a practical and also succinct project strategy (Software Companies in Indianapolis). The software program needs to automate specific jobs, boost performance, or optimize processes.

The Of Software Companies In Indianapolis

With Dev, Zero, designers can develop brand-new atmospheres by logging onto a console and also picking from different templates or producing their own templates. Whenever required, developers can easily share their atmospheres, so others can communicate with solutions operating on their themes. To find out more, make sure to check out the Dev, No item page.

The three main areas of development preparation are Requirements Collecting, Planning and Style, as well as Study as well as explanation Development. The major stakeholders are generally customers, so target examinations can be a great means to clear up key concerns when functioning with a small example of the target market.

Features are broken down into smaller tasks to make sure that they can be estimated extra precisely. The phase is a little bit comparable to the planning stage. When some significant functions are new, essential, and dangerous, you need to carry out research about their application to minimize these dangers in the manufacturing stage.

To create an efficient software application growth strategy, it is extremely crucial to comprehend exactly how essential its quality is to the success of the item. Below are the most typical stages of a software application development job. You can utilize them as a guide when describing the phases and aspects of any project.

The Basic Principles Of Software Companies In Indianapolis

Just how does this project fit into the mission and objectives of the company? Does the company have sufficient sources to make the project a success? Just how does this task fit in with the schedule of various other projects and goals?

Software Companies in IndianapolisSoftware Companies in Indianapolis
This clearness makes it less complicated to anticipate the end result of the project, both for the customer and also for the business. Defining objectives is likewise important for creating a realistic and concise project strategy. The software program should automate specific tasks, increase efficiency, or enhance processes. The precise objective needs to be clear (Software Companies in Indianapolis).

Report this wiki page